Buscar

Apol 1 Nota 100 Integração de Sistemas Legados

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 3, do total de 3 páginas

Prévia do material em texto

Questão 1/5 - Integração de Sistemas Legados (E)
Com relação à migração de dados de um sistema legado, marque a alternativa incorreta:
.
Nota: 20.0
	
	A
	No processo de migração de dados, é importante que a filtragem de dados relevantes seja feita no final da migração.
Você acertou!
Comentário. É importante que a filtragem de dados seja feita antes do início da migração de dados. Assim, dados inválidos deixarão de ser migrados para o novo sistema.
	
	B
	Migrações de dados costumam ser separadas em duas etapas: a extração e a carga dos dados.
	
	C
	O foco de uma migração deve ser a migração da menor quantidade de dados possível, para que a aplicação destino possa entrar em funcionamento o mais rápido possível.
	
	D
	O processo de transformação de dados pode ocorrer na etapa de extração ou na etapa de carga dos dados.
Questão 2/5 - Integração de Sistemas Legados (E)
Com relação à reengenharia de sistemas legados para arquitetura orientada a objetos, qual é a alternativa correta?
.
Nota: 20.0
	
	A
	Engenharia de software orientado a objetos não é o principal paradigma de desenvolvimento entre organizações de desenvolvimento de software.
	
	B
	Algoritmos e estruturas de dados de aplicações não orientadas a objetos podem ser utilizadas em um sistema orientado a objetos.
Você acertou!
Comentário. Sistemas orientados a objetos podem utilizar bibliotecas feitas em outros paradigmas de desenvolvimento de software, que não seja o paradigma de orientação a objetos.
	
	C
	A engenharia reversa não é considerada reengenharia de sistemas para arquitetura orientada a objetos.
	
	D
	Não é possível criar diagramas de caso de uso (UML) para especificar novos requisitos do sistema a ser migrado.
Questão 3/5 - Integração de Sistemas Legados (E)
Sobre fatores de sucesso de uma migração de dados, assinale a alternativa incorreta:
.
Nota: 20.0
	
	A
	Regras de validação devem ser utilizadas como primeiro passo para tentar identificar e corrigir erros nos dados nos sistemas fonte.
	
	B
	Transformações de dados do sistema fonte para o sistema destino não serão definidas somente no mapeamento dos dados, mas serão executadas com funções de lógica de negócio, que serão essenciais para carregarem estruturas de dados mais complexas. 
	
	C
	A migração de dados deve ser tratada como uma atividade dentro de um projeto.
Você acertou!
Comentário. Por causa da sua complexidade, a migração de dados deve ser tratada como um projeto, e não apenas como uma atividade.
	
	D
	Realizar tarefas manuais da migração de dados com atenção.
Questão 4/5 - Integração de Sistemas Legados (E)
Qual dos fatores abaixo não é um fator de avaliação técnica de sistemas? (Assinale a alternativa correta):
.
Nota: 20.0
	
	A
	Desempenho.
	
	B
	Custos de manutenção.
	
	C
	Processos de negócio suportados.
Você acertou!
Comentário. Processos de negócio suportados é um fator de avaliação de valor de negócio, e não de qualidade técnica de um sistema.
	
	D
	Gerenciamento de configuração.
Questão 5/5 - Integração de Sistemas Legados (E)
Sobre sistemas legados, analise as afirmativas a seguir e marque (V) para as verdadeiras ou (F) para as falsas. Depois, assinale a alternativa que apresenta a sequência correta.
( ) Costumam ser sistemas críticos para o funcionamento de negócios.
( ) Sua estrutura tende a se degradar ao longo do tempo.
( ) Algumas definições descrevem sistemas legados como sistemas cujo código não possui testes automatizados.
( ) São de fácil substituição.
Nota: 20.0
	
	A
	V – V – V – F.
Você acertou!
Comentário. Sistemas legados são críticos para o funcionamento de negócios e, por este motivo, são difíceis de serem substituídos. Sua estrutura tende a se degradar ao longo do tempo devido ao processo de evolução pelo qual este tipo de sistema passa, que pode durar décadas. Em interpretações mais práticas no desenvolvimento de sistemas, código legado é considerado código sem testes, e sistemas legados são compostos por código legado.
	
	B
	V – F – V – F.
	
	C
	F – V – V – F.
	
	D
	V – V – F – F.

Outros materiais